Description

Antique Carved Oak Sideboard Dresser Base. This wonderful carved oak sideboard dresser base has a lovely oak top with a moulded edge. Under having two drawers to the centre with carved detail to the drawer fronts Flanked either side by a cupboard. The cupboard doors have lovely carved detail. Supported by carved baluster supports at the front with potboard display shelf under.

A Jacobean style carved oak dresser base typically features solid oak construction, rich dark tones, and geometric or arcaded carvings. Originating in the 17th century and later revived in the Victorian and Edwardian eras, these pieces combine central drawer storage with side cupboards and often a low shelf known as a pot board.

Traditional antique oak sideboards were crafted using solid European oak, featuring mortise and tenon joints, hand-dovetailed drawers, and pegged construction. Decorative elements included hand-carved arch panels, gadrooned borders, and turned bulbous legs.

Authentic antique oak pieces show signs of historic hand-planing, irregular wear on wooden drawer runners, and natural shrinkage across wide timber panels. Examining the reverse and drawer undersides for hand-sawn wood marks and historic iron or wooden peg fixings also helps confirm age.

Maintain the timber by dusting regularly with a soft dry cloth and applying a quality beeswax polish once or twice a year in the direction of the grain. Keep the item away from direct heat sources and radiator vents to prevent the solid oak panels from drying out or splitting.
